Where is Find My Mac located?
To activate Find My on Mac, click on the Apple icon on the menu bar, then choose ‘System Preferences’. Choose ‘Apple ID’. Select ‘iCloud’ in the sidebar, then choose ‘Find My Mac’ and click ‘Allow’ (if asked) to allow Find My Mac to use the location of your Mac. Why isn’t my Mac showing up on Find My iPhone?
Maybe you signed in to iCloud.com or Find My iPhone with a different Apple ID than on the device that you don’t see listed. To check, sign in to Find My iPhone or iCloud.com with your other Apple ID accounts and look for your device. In upcoming versions of iOS and macOS, the new Find My feature will broadcast Bluetooth signals from Apple devices even when they’re offline, allowing nearby Apple devices to relay their location to the cloud. That should help you locate your stolen laptop even when it’s sleeping in a thief’s bag.Can I Find My Mac if it’s off?
You can still track your device’s location while it’s locked as long as it’s connected to the Internet. If it’s offline, the actions will take effect the next time your Mac is online.
